如何动态获取Django模型类?

4 浏览
0 Comments

如何动态获取Django模型类?

在没有完整的Django模型路径的情况下,是否可以像这样做:

model = 'User' [在Django命名空间中]
model.objects.all()

...而不是:

User.objects.all().

编辑:我正在尝试根据命令行输入进行此调用。是否可以避免导入语句,例如:

model = django.authx.models.User

而不会出现Django返回的错误:

"全局名称django未定义。"

0